Rest in Peace Professor Pupupadi Sundararajan

The Department of Chemistry of Carleton University is sad to share the passing of Dr. Pudupadi (Sundar) Sundararajan (1943 - 2021). Sundar died suddenly on September 14, 2021. 

Sundar completed his D.Sc. at the Ramachandran Institute of the University of Madras. He completed postdoctoral fellowships at the Université de Montréal with Professor Bob Marchessault and Stanford University with Professor Paul Flory. Sundar then spent 25 years as a research scientist and manager at the Xerox Research Centre in Mississauga, Ontario. After retiring from Xerox, he took on an NSERC-Xerox Chair position in the Department of Chemistry at Carleton University and retired as an accomplished academic. He was recognized with the Macromolecular Science and Engineering Award of the Chemical Institute of Canada and the Materials Chemistry Award of the Canadian Materials Society. He was also named as a Fellow of the Chemical Institute of Canada. He mentored many students, authored books and hundreds of scientific papers. Notably, he published the text Physical Aspects of Polymer Self-Assembly in 2016. He served as president of the Canadian Chemical Society and chair of the Chemical Institute of Canada
